Joint Pain
Joint pain is something that we're all going to experience at some point in life, especially as we move towards the older years. But even as young healthy people, we will have all of the joint aches and pains that older people have. It's due to the work we do, and the way we look after our body. People who sit in offices a day are known for their problems with joint pain, but mainly in the neck. But neck pain isn't something that should be ignored, and just shrugged off because you know it's related to your job. You should start practicing a better position at work, ensure that your back is straight and you're not slumped over. This will straighten your posture, and allow your neck to sit in a neutral position rather than tilted. It takes all of that pressure off the neck joint. Doing light rolls of your head and neck stretches to relieve any tension is also advised!

3 Health Changes To Make As You Reach Middle Age

Looking after your health gets so much harder as you get older. When you’re young, it feels like you can bounce back from anything and you don’t need to worry too much. It’s still important that you try to get into good health habits but you can afford to make a few mistakes along the way. But when you start to hit middle age and your risk of disease begins to increase, it’s so important that you start thinking more seriously about your health. If you don’t, you’ll struggle to manage it when you’re older and you’ll be far more likely to have serious health problems. If you haven’t thought about it much, these are some of the biggest health changes you need to make as you reach middle age.

Photo from Pixabay

Diet And Exercise
Diet and exercise are so important at any age, but when you start to get older, you need to prioritize it. Your risk of things like heart disease and strokes are massively increased and you need to make sure that you’re doing everything that you can to reduce that risk as much as possible. Diet is a good place to start because if you’re eating a lot of fatty foods and sugar, your heart health is really going to suffer. Drinking a lot of alcohol has a big impact too. You need to cut those unhealthy foods out of your diet and replace them with more healthy alternatives.

Exercise is so important for heart health as well and if you’re doing a good amount of cardio on a regular basis, your risk of heart attacks and strokes is massively reduced. Staying active will also help you to keep your joints in good working order so they don’t seize up as you get older. You don’t have to be an athlete, but it’s important that you stay active, even if you’re just walking on a regular basis.

Get Regular Tests 
When you’re young, there isn’t really much need to go for regular tests on things like your sight or your hearing unless you notice a problem. But as you start to get older, these things will start to go. However, if you can catch the problem early and get some glasses or hearing aids, you can limit the damage and stop the problem from getting worse. If you leave it though, you’re likely to lose your hearing completely and have serious vision problems in later life.
